The primary achievement of Adventure is its distinct sonic palette. Madeon utilized a "pop-electro" hybrid style characterized by complex layering and "glitch" editing techniques. Unlike the aggressive EDM prevalent at the time, Adventure leaned into melodic richness.

Tracks like "Pay No Mind" (featuring Passion Pit) and "You're On" showcase a mastery of funk-infused basslines and shimmering synthesizers. Leclercq’s production is notoriously meticulous; every micro-sample and drum fill is placed with surgical intent, yet the result never feels cold. Madeon’s debut studio album, Adventure (2015), stands as a definitive landmark in the mid-2010s electronic landscape. It represents the evolution of Hugo Leclercq from a viral "mashup kid" into a sophisticated architect of synth-pop. By blending the high-energy foundations of French House with a cinematic, coming-of-age narrative, Leclercq created an album that feels both technologically precise and deeply human.
